RICHMONT MINES ANNOUNCES APPOINTMENT OF MR. RENAUD ADAMS TO THE POSITION OF PRESIDENT AND CHIEF EXECUTIVE OFFICER

MONTREAL, Quebec, Canada, October 17, 2014 - Richmont Mines Inc. (TSX - NYSE MKT: RIC) (“Richmont” or the “Corporation”) is very pleased to announce the appointment of Mr. Renaud Adams to the position of President and Chief Executive Officer effective November 15, 2014.

Mr. Adams has 20 years of mining experience, and most recently served as President and Chief Operating Officer at Primero Mining Corp. Prior to this, Mr. Adams served as Senior Vice-President, Americas Operations, at IAMGOLD Corporation, and held various senior positions with Cambior Inc. and Breakwater Resources Ltd. Mr. Adams holds a Bachelor of Engineering degree in Mining and Mineral Processing from Laval University.

Mr. Greg Chamandy, Executive Chairman of Richmont’s Board of Directors commented on the appointment: “We are very pleased to have been able to attract a high-caliber individual like Mr. Adams to our team as President and CEO. His experience in the gold sector will be of tremendous benefit to Richmont, and will enhance the development of our high-grade gold resource below our Island Gold Mine in Ontario, which is currently a 1.1 million ounce inferred resource. I would like to extend my sincere thanks to our Director, Ms. Elaine Ellingham, for her dedication during her time as Interim President and CEO, and greatly appreciate that she will be assisting Mr. Adams during the transition.”

Elaine Ellingham, Interim President and CEO said: “The appointment of Mr. Adams adds valuable insight and leadership experience to our management team. His extensive mining experience and technical background will complement our existing technical team and will play a vital and instrumental role in driving the future value of our new resource at Island Gold. I am looking forward to assisting Mr. Adams as he transitions into his new role, and look forward to working with him in my continuing role as a member of Richmont’s Board of Directors.”

About Richmont Mines Inc.
Richmont Mines has produced over 1.4 million ounces of gold from its operations in Quebec, Ontario and Newfoundland since beginning production in 1991. The Corporation currently produces gold from the Island Gold Mine in Ontario, and the Beaufor and Monique Mines in Quebec. The Corporation is also advancing development of the extension at depth of the Island Gold Mine in Ontario. With over 20 years of experience in gold production, exploration and development, and prudent financial management, the Corporation is well-positioned to cost-effectively build its Canadian reserve base and to successfully enter its next phase of growth. RICHMONT MINES ANNOUNCES RESIGNATION OF DIRECTOR

MONTREAL, Quebec, Canada, October 17, 2014 - Richmont Mines Inc. (TSX - NYSE MKT: RIC) (“Richmont” or the “Corporation”) announces the resignation of Dr. James Gill from the Corporation’s Board of Directors, effective October 17, 2014.

The Board of Directors would like to express their appreciation for his contributions during his tenure as a Director of Richmont.
